How to Actually Use the Best Brand New Online Casinos 2026 UK Welcome Bonus (Without Losing Your Shirt)
This is the strategy I use. It is not a get-rich-quick scheme. It is a method to survive the bonus system.
- Filter by wagering: Look for anything 35x or lower. 30x is gold. Do not touch 45x or 50x. It is a mathematical loss.
- Check the ‘max bet’ rule: While using a bonus, you usually cannot bet more than £5 per spin. Some strict sites cap it at £2.50. If you accidentally bet £6, you void the bonus. I have done this. It hurts.
- Look at the ‘max cashout’: The best brand new online casinos 2026 UK welcome bonus packages often cap your winnings at 10x or 15x the bonus amount. So, a £50 bonus means you can only cash out £500 from that bonus. Read that number carefully.
- Deposit via PayPal or Trustly: Avoid credit cards for the initial deposit. The new UKGC rules are strict, and PayPal often has the fastest withdrawal times for new sites.
Responsible Gambling Tools You Need to Set Up Immediately
I play late at night. It is easy to get tunnel vision. The new sites are actually better at this than the old guard. They have built-in ‘night mode’ themes that are easier on the eyes, and they force you to set deposit limits before you claim the bonus.
Here is what I do immediately after registering:
- Deposit Limit: I set a daily limit of £50. Not negotiable. The site will ask you to confirm this before you can spin. If they don’t, it is a red flag.
- Reality Check: I set it to pop up every 30 minutes. It shows me my net loss/gain. It is annoying, but it saves me from chasing losses at 4 AM.
- Self-Exclusion (Cool-off): If I feel the itch to chase a loss, I use the ‘time out’ function for 24 hours. Most new sites let you do this instantly from the settings menu.
I saw a new site last week that had a ‘Loss Limit’ tied directly to the welcome bonus. If you hit your loss limit, the bonus automatically deactivates. That is responsible design. It should be standard.
